Inspector’s narrative

What the inspector wrote

Licensing Program Analyst (LPA), Cortney Nelson, met with the Applicant, Jaime Allen, for follow-up visit to review the outside area of the facility. Upon arrival, LPA was admitted into the facility by Jaime and toured inside and outside. Jaime states that she is planning to operate the facility from 8:00AM-5:00PM and will now serve children ages 2 years through entry into first grade. LPA advised that children shall not be admitted once they begin attending public/private school as they would then be considered "school-age" children. LPA further advised that includes transitional kindergarten (TK) and kindergarten. An updated LIC200A was completed today. LPA advised Jaime of options relating to operation of her family child care home (FCCH) when the facility becomes licensed. LPA advised that as long as a qualified site director is employed and present at the facility, Jaime can continue to operate her FCCH. LPA further advised options of placing either the center or the FCCH on inactive status using the request form (LIC9211) if needed. Jaime states that she is planning to operate the center and her FCCH once licensed and LPA advised submitting a directors packet for the employee. A list of required documents to be submitted was provided to Jaime. LPA toured the outside area and observed that it is equipped with tables, planter boxes, a sandbox, grass area, and other play equipment. There is an off-limits shed that LPA advised securing the space beneath to prevent animals and other vermin from living underneath it. The farthest back area of the outdoor area has weeds currently and LPA advised maintaining or removing the weeds once they have died so it is not a fire hazard. Exit interview conducted and report was reviewed with the Applicant, Jaime Allen. LPA advised that a license for a child care center will be issued pending manager review and approval and submission of site director packet.
